Independent learning becomes manageable when approached as a series of intentional, short experiments. Rather than overhauling habits overnight, micro-experiments let learners test approaches, measure outcomes, and iterate quickly. This article outlines practical ways to design small trials that reveal what sticks and what needs adjustment. Use these steps to accelerate progress without overwhelming time or motivation.

Start with micro-experiments

Begin by framing one clear question you want to answer about your learning—for example, whether shorter daily reviews beat longer weekly sessions for retention. Design an experiment that runs one to two weeks with a simple, repeatable routine and a measurable outcome. Keep the scope narrow so you can complete the trial and gather usable data without losing momentum.

  • Example: Ten minutes of spaced flashcards each morning for seven days.
  • Example: Two focused 25-minute practice sessions instead of a single hour.
  • Example: Explaining a concept aloud once per day to test recall strength.

Micro-experiments reduce decision fatigue and create achievable wins. They make it easier to compare approaches and identify what aligns with your schedule and cognitive patterns.

Create fast feedback loops

Feedback is the core of any experiment. Decide how you will measure progress before you start—self-assessments, quick quizzes, performance logs, or recorded practice sessions all work. Collect data daily or at the end of each session so you can spot trends early and avoid committing to ineffective routines for too long.

Short feedback cycles encourage adaptation and keep motivation high. When results are visible, it becomes easier to refine methods or abandon strategies that aren’t delivering.

Track what matters

Focus tracking on two to three meaningful indicators rather than every metric you can imagine. Useful indicators include accuracy on brief quizzes, time-on-task with distraction notes, and subjective confidence ratings after practice. Consistent, lightweight tracking reveals patterns without creating extra work that undermines the experiment.

Keep records simple and review them weekly to detect small but meaningful gains. Over time, these snapshots build a reliable picture of what supports your learning.

Scale insights into routines

Once a micro-experiment shows consistent improvement, scale it into a sustainable routine by gradually increasing duration, complexity, or frequency. Pair successful techniques with contextual cues—times of day, locations, or pre-study rituals—to make the habit stick. Periodically run new experiments to refine and adapt as your goals evolve.

Scaling should be deliberate and paced to prevent burnout. Treat routines as living systems that respond to ongoing testing and adjustment.
